Key Takeaways

1. Find Your Passion and Talent: The Foundation of Success

"The Success Equation in Three Feet from Gold will show you how."

Discover your purpose. The first step towards success is identifying what you're passionate about and what you excel at. This combination forms the foundation of your personal Success Equation. To find your passion:

  • List ten things that make your heart sing
  • Identify activities that bring you fulfillment
  • Reflect on times when you felt most alive

To recognize your talents:

  • List ten things you're really good at
  • Ask friends and family what they think you excel in
  • Consider skills you've developed throughout your life

By combining your passion with your talent, you create a powerful synergy that can drive you towards success in any field.

3. Persevere Through Adversity: You're Three Feet from Gold

"Every adversity, every failure and every heartache carries with it the seed of an equivalent or greater benefit."

Embrace challenges as opportunities. The story of R.U. Darby, who gave up on his gold mine just three feet from striking it rich, illustrates the importance of perseverance. When facing obstacles:

  • Reframe setbacks as learning experiences
  • Develop resilience by focusing on long-term goals
  • Remember that success often comes after multiple failures

Many successful people faced numerous rejections and failures before achieving their goals. For example:

  • Thomas Edison made thousands of unsuccessful attempts before inventing the light bulb
  • J.K. Rowling was rejected by multiple publishers before Harry Potter was accepted
  • Steve Jobs was fired from Apple before returning to lead it to unprecedented success

By persevering through adversity, you increase your chances of reaching your own "gold mine" of success.

5. Create Your Personal Success Equation

"((P + T) x A x A) + F = Your Success Equation"

Apply the formula to your life. The Success Equation combines Passion (P) and Talent (T), multiplied by Association (A) and Action (A), plus Faith (F). To implement this equation:

  1. Identify your passion and talent (as discussed in Takeaway 1)
  2. Choose the right associations:
    • List five successful people you know
    • Identify groups or organizations that align with your goals
    • Seek out mentors in your field of interest
  3. Take consistent action:
    • Set specific, measurable goals
    • Create a daily action plan
    • Hold yourself accountable or find an accountability partner
  4. Maintain faith in yourself and your journey:
    • Practice positive self-talk
    • Visualize your success
    • Celebrate small wins along the way

By consciously applying each element of the Success Equation, you increase your chances of achieving your goals and realizing your full potential.

What's "Three Feet from Gold" about?

  • Inspirational Journey: "Three Feet from Gold" by Sharon L. Lechter is a motivational book that combines a fictional narrative with real-life success stories to illustrate the importance of perseverance and determination.
  • Central Theme: The book is based on the concept that many people give up just before they achieve success, as illustrated by the story of a gold miner who quit three feet from a major gold vein.
  • Personal Growth: It follows the journey of Greg, a struggling entrepreneur, who learns valuable life lessons from successful business leaders and applies them to his own life.
  • Napoleon Hill's Influence: The book is inspired by the principles of Napoleon Hill, particularly those found in "Think and Grow Rich," and aims to provide a modern take on these timeless success strategies.

What is the "Success Equation" in "Three Feet from Gold"?

  • Components of Success: The Success Equation is ((P + T) x A x A) + F, where P stands for Passion, T for Talent, A for Association, and F for Faith.
  • Passion and Talent: Combining what you love (passion) with what you are good at (talent) is the foundation of success.
  • Association and Action: Surrounding yourself with the right people (association) and taking decisive steps (action) are crucial for progress.
  • Faith: Believing in yourself and your goals is the glue that holds the equation together, enabling perseverance through challenges.

What is the significance of the title "Three Feet from Gold"?

  • Metaphor for Persistence: The title is a metaphor for the idea that success is often just within reach, and many people give up too soon.
  • Origin of the Story: It refers to a story in Napoleon Hill's "Think and Grow Rich" about a miner who quit just three feet from a major gold vein.
  • Central Theme: The title encapsulates the book's central theme of perseverance and the importance of not giving up in the face of adversity.
  • Inspiration for Readers: It serves as a reminder to readers that they may be closer to achieving their goals than they realize.

About the Author

Sharon L. Lechter CPA is a bestselling author, entrepreneur, and financial literacy advocate. She co-authored "Rich Dad Poor Dad" with Robert Kiyosaki, which became an international sensation. Lechter has written numerous books on financial education and success principles. She is a sought-after speaker and mentor, focusing on empowering individuals to achieve financial independence. Lechter has served on the President's Advisory Council on Financial Literacy and is actively involved in various charitable organizations. Her work with the Napoleon Hill Foundation led to the creation of "Three Feet from Gold," which aims to modernize Hill's success principles for contemporary readers. Lechter's expertise in accounting and business has made her a respected voice in personal finance and entrepreneurship.
